• Artigos

    Git-flow o anti-pattern mais querido da galera

    O Git-flow se tornou bastante popular nos últimos anos como uma forma de organizar o fluxo de trabalho no desenvolvimento de software, usando uma das mais versáteis características do git: branchs. No entanto, não existe bala de prata. E o git-flow vem se mostrando uma solução over engineered, e, do meu ponto de vista, um anti-pattern. Vamos entender o por que e conhecer uma alternativa mais eficiente. Problemas do Git-flow Um problema que me faz não gostar do git-flow é o fato do histórico se tornar uma macarronada impossível de se gerenciar. O histórico do controle de versão é justamente a motivação para se usar um versionador de código. Tornar o histórico ilegível faz com que…